Man Flying to Cuba Tells AA Gate Agent at MIA: No Lithium Batteries, ‘but I Have a Bomb,’ Cops Say

Yoel Guevara-Crespo was taken into custody after a K9 search found no explosives and American Airlines resumed normal operations, authorities said.

Summary by WPLG
Deputies say a man flying to Cuba confirmed with an American Airlines gate agent at Miami International Airport Monday morning that he didn’t have any laptop batteries in his bag ― but what he claimed he did have ensured that he would not make it to the island.

The arrest report details that, when asked "standard security questions" about whether he was carrying lithium batteries or incendiary devices, he allegedly replied, "No, but I have a bomb."
